Hey guys I\\\'ve come with a solution for preventing a Software being pirated. Okay they say that after Cloud Computing there won\\\'t be any Piracy; I\\\'m not talking about that at all.

Here us my idea: All Computer\'s have a organisation name while installing a OS. Why can\\\'t I use that information for preventing Piracy? Suppose I\\\'m selling a new software product from my company (by any means), after getting the organization\\\'s name from the user, I\\\'ll have a tiny module which will compile each time when user register\\\'s the company. So I don\\\'t need complex serial key algo\\\'s to generate different key\\\'s and if a user uses a OS with same organisations, he/she can use only the Software from a particular organization. The Pirate\\\'s have to install a new OS for different Organization name for a different Software, which is practically impossible.

Well,

Lets look at windows, open the registry, navigate to H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\\SOFTWARE\\Microsoft\\Windows NT\\CurrentVersion, change the key entries RegisteredOrganization and RegisterdOwner, and thats it, you are now in a new Organization and Owner. :evil:
